Teya is a payment and software service provider, headquartered in London serving small, local businesses across Europe. Founded in 2019, we build easy to use, integrated tools that enable our members to accept payments and boost business performance.

What You’ll Do
  • Own the Credit Vision & Strategy: Define and deliver a roadmap covering first-party lending, embedded credit experiences, and third-party lending partnerships.

  • Lead End-to-End Product Lifecycle: From onboarding and risk assessment to servicing, collections, and renewals.

  • Build Scalable Platforms: Develop underwriting and decisioning systems leveraging bureau data, open banking, behavioral analytics, and proprietary merchant signals.

  • Drive Data-Led Strategies: Optimize approval rates, pricing models, and risk tiers while managing portfolio performance.

  • Shape Credit Economics: Collaborate with C-suite to balance growth, loss rates, capital efficiency, and RoE.

  • Ensure Regulatory Compliance: Work closely with Risk and Compliance to meet UK/EU frameworks for KYC/KYB, affordability, and responsible lending.

  • Expand Through Partnerships: Forge strong relationships with third-party lenders to broaden product availability and optimize commercial terms.

  • Go-to-Market Leadership: Align Sales, Marketing, Risk, and Operations for successful launches across all markets.

  • Market Research & Competitive Analysis: Stay ahead of trends in SME lending, alternative financing, and embedded credit.

  • Influence at the Highest Level: Communicate priorities and performance to senior leadership, shaping strategy across Banking and Acquiring.

  • Build & Mentor Teams: Lead a high-performing team across Product, Data Science, and Credit Ops.

Experience & Skill-set
  • Experience: 10+ years in credit product or lending strategy roles within fintech, commercial lending, or neobanks.

  • Track Record: Proven success launching or scaling SME lending products with strong portfolio performance.

  • Expertise: Deep knowledge of credit decisioning, scoring models, affordability, pricing, risk segmentation, fraud prevention, and capital allocation.

  • Regulatory Knowledge: Strong understanding of UK/EU frameworks (AML/KYC/KYB, open banking, responsible lending).

  • Commercial Acumen: Ability to model unit economics, design pricing strategies, and balance growth vs. risk.

  • Leadership: Skilled at building cross-functional teams and influencing across Engineering, Data, Risk, Finance, Legal, and Sales.

  • Communication: Exceptional ability to present insights and strategies to senior leadership and external partners.

  • Data-Driven Mindset: Experience using analytics and experimentation to improve approval rates, conversion, and repayment.

What you need to know about the Bristol Tech Scene

Along with Gloucester, Swindon and Bath, Bristol is part of the "Silicon Gorge" tech hub, a region in the U.K. renowned for its high-tech and research-driven industries, with a particular emphasis on sustainability and reducing environmental impact. As the European Green Capital, Bristol is home to 25,000 cleantech companies, including Baker Hughes and unicorn Ovo Energy. The city has committed to achieving net-zero emissions within the next decade.
